I dont think its the blower.....the blower is fine with the air or fan on. It's just when i adj the temp up that i get the click. It clicks....blows fine....just no heat.
 
In your avatar pic your 4runner looks like a 99+ Limited... If that's the case, it should be equipped with a climate control system that is controlled by electric servos/motors.

On older 4Runners the climate controls are attached to mechanical levers that open and close the air mix vents and change the arrangement of the airflow from defroster to face to foot to face/foot mix, etc.

Since yours is controlled electronically, when you change the position of the temperature control, it sends an electronic signal to a servo motor that changes the position of the air mix flap. When you adjust it to the highest temp setting, that servo motor is trying to change the flap into a position where the ducts are being fed only by air forced through the heater by the blower.

I think the servo motor controlling that flap may be stuck or malfunctioning. That would explain the quiet blower, and no heat, and clicking. That's my thoughts on it.

The digital controls have a self-diagnostic routine that puts trouble codes on the Temp read-out. No reader needed. Go to the on-line FSM for instructions and code explanations. It should be able to test your servos and sensors.
